Transaction 39e660e83162629b56d836cfb1018c50570e47fccc376f03104dc0cd31dd4bb4
1 Input
1 Output
-
39e660e83162629b56d836cfb1018c50570e47fccc376f03104dc0cd31dd4bb4:0
- value
- 115159
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fef40dc63fb016e5cf4cae3b187760d41f1e91a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MR4JPoxVEL7Et7VE6b6PYhdcutteNxTbZ